[src/trunk]: src/sys Simplify by using atomic_swap instead of mutex



details:   https://anonhg.NetBSD.org/src/rev/a61348f79d9f
branches:  trunk
changeset: 346660:a61348f79d9f
user:      ozaki-r <ozaki-r%NetBSD.org@localhost>
date:      Tue Jul 26 05:53:30 2016 +0000

description:
Simplify by using atomic_swap instead of mutex

Suggested by kefren@

diffstat:

 sys/netinet/ip_flow.c   |  18 ++++++++----------
 sys/netinet6/ip6_flow.c |  18 ++++++++----------
 2 files changed, 16 insertions(+), 20 deletions(-)

diffs (135 lines):

diff -r b87f28c8aa5d -r a61348f79d9f sys/netinet/ip_flow.c
--- a/sys/netinet/ip_flow.c     Tue Jul 26 05:52:55 2016 +0000
+++ b/sys/netinet/ip_flow.c     Tue Jul 26 05:53:30 2016 +0000
@@ -1,4 +1,4 @@
-/*     $NetBSD: ip_flow.c,v 1.73 2016/07/11 07:37:00 ozaki-r Exp $     */
+/*     $NetBSD: ip_flow.c,v 1.74 2016/07/26 05:53:30 ozaki-r Exp $     */
 
 /*-
  * Copyright (c) 1998 The NetBSD Foundation, Inc.
@@ -30,7 +30,7 @@
  */
 
 #include <sys/cdefs.h>
-__KERNEL_RCSID(0, "$NetBSD: ip_flow.c,v 1.73 2016/07/11 07:37:00 ozaki-r Exp $");
+__KERNEL_RCSID(0, "$NetBSD: ip_flow.c,v 1.74 2016/07/26 05:53:30 ozaki-r Exp $");
 
 #include <sys/param.h>
 #include <sys/systm.h>
@@ -46,6 +46,7 @@
 #include <sys/pool.h>
 #include <sys/sysctl.h>
 #include <sys/workqueue.h>
+#include <sys/atomic.h>
 
 #include <net/if.h>
 #include <net/if_dl.h>
@@ -430,7 +431,7 @@
        return NULL;
 }
 
-static bool ipflow_work_enqueued = false;
+static unsigned int ipflow_work_enqueued = 0;
 
 static void
 ipflow_slowtimo_work(struct work *wk, void *arg)
@@ -439,6 +440,9 @@
        struct ipflow *ipf, *next_ipf;
        uint64_t *ips;
 
+       /* We can allow enqueuing another work at this point */
+       atomic_swap_uint(&ipflow_work_enqueued, 0);
+
        mutex_enter(softnet_lock);
        mutex_enter(&ipflow_lock);
        KERNEL_LOCK(1, NULL);
@@ -458,7 +462,6 @@
                        ipf->ipf_uses = 0;
                }
        }
-       ipflow_work_enqueued = false;
        KERNEL_UNLOCK_ONE(NULL);
        mutex_exit(&ipflow_lock);
        mutex_exit(softnet_lock);
@@ -469,13 +472,8 @@
 {
 
        /* Avoid enqueuing another work when one is already enqueued */
-       mutex_enter(&ipflow_lock);
-       if (ipflow_work_enqueued) {
-               mutex_exit(&ipflow_lock);
+       if (atomic_swap_uint(&ipflow_work_enqueued, 1) == 1)
                return;
-       }
-       ipflow_work_enqueued = true;
-       mutex_exit(&ipflow_lock);
 
        workqueue_enqueue(ipflow_slowtimo_wq, &ipflow_slowtimo_wk, NULL);
 }
